Changeset 2953 for trunk/oscam.c


Ignore:
Timestamp:
08/25/10 19:11:44 (10 years ago)
Author:
rorothetroll
Message:

added Seagate FreeAgent DockStar support. thanks Robby

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/oscam.c

    r2949 r2953  
    340340#ifdef CS_LED
    341341              cs_switch_led(LED1B, LED_OFF);
    342               cs_switch_led(LED1A, LED_ON);
    343342              cs_switch_led(LED2, LED_OFF);
    344343              cs_switch_led(LED3, LED_OFF);
     344              cs_switch_led(LED1A, LED_ON);
    345345#endif
    346346              if (cfg->pidfile != NULL) {
     
    32093209        FILE *f;
    32103210
    3211         switch(led){
    3212         case LED1A:snprintf(ledfile, 255, "/sys/class/leds/nslu2:red:status/brightness");
    3213         break;
    3214         case LED1B:snprintf(ledfile, 255, "/sys/class/leds/nslu2:green:ready/brightness");
    3215         break;
    3216         case LED2:snprintf(ledfile, 255, "/sys/class/leds/nslu2:green:disk-1/brightness");
    3217         break;
    3218         case LED3:snprintf(ledfile, 255, "/sys/class/leds/nslu2:green:disk-2/brightness");
    3219         break;
    3220         }
     3211        #ifdef DOCKSTAR
     3212            switch(led){
     3213            case LED1A:snprintf(ledfile, 255, "/sys/class/leds/dockstar:orange:misc/brightness");
     3214            break;
     3215            case LED1B:snprintf(ledfile, 255, "/sys/class/leds/dockstar:green:health/brightness");
     3216            break;
     3217            case LED2:snprintf(ledfile, 255, "/sys/class/leds/dockstar:green:health/brightness");
     3218            break;
     3219            case LED3:snprintf(ledfile, 255, "/sys/class/leds/dockstar:orange:misc/brightness");
     3220            break;
     3221            }
     3222        #else       
     3223            switch(led){
     3224            case LED1A:snprintf(ledfile, 255, "/sys/class/leds/nslu2:red:status/brightness");
     3225            break;
     3226            case LED1B:snprintf(ledfile, 255, "/sys/class/leds/nslu2:green:ready/brightness");
     3227            break;
     3228            case LED2:snprintf(ledfile, 255, "/sys/class/leds/nslu2:green:disk-1/brightness");
     3229            break;
     3230            case LED3:snprintf(ledfile, 255, "/sys/class/leds/nslu2:green:disk-2/brightness");
     3231            break;
     3232            }
     3233        #endif
    32213234
    32223235        if (!(f=fopen(ledfile, "w"))){
Note: See TracChangeset for help on using the changeset viewer.